Foundation Stabilizing Services
Foundation stabilizing services involve the use of specialized techniques and equipment to reinforce and restore the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, piering, and slab jacking, which aim to correct uneven settling, shifting, or sinking of the foundation. By addressing these issues, foundation stabilizing helps maintain the stability of the property and prevents further damage to the structure. Local service providers assess the specific needs of each property and determine the most appropriate stabilization approach to ensure long-term support.
These services are essential for resolving common foundation problems caused by so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or aging materials. When a foundation begins to settle unevenly, it can lead to issues such as cracked walls, uneven floors, and misaligned door and window frames. Foundation stabilizing helps mitigate these problems by providing a firm, level base for the building. It can also prevent more severe structural issues from developing, which might otherwise require costly repairs or even property replacement. Cost Range for Foundation Stabilizing - Typical costs for foundation stabilizing services can vary widely, generally falling between $2,000 and $7,000. For example, homeowners in Westlake, OH, might see prices around $3,500 for standard stabilization projects.
Factors Influencing Cost - The total expense depends on factors such as the extent of foundation movement and the method used, with prices potentially reaching $10,000 for extensive repairs. Smaller projects may cost as little as $1,500.
Average Service Costs - On average, foundation stabilization services tend to cost between $4,000 and $6,000. Local providers often provide free estimates to determine specific project needs and costs.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include excavation, soil injection, or pier installation,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all price. These variations depend on the specific conditions of the foundation and soil.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ve methods to reinforce and support a building's foundation to prevent or repair settling, cracking, or shifting issues.
How do professionals determine if foundation stabilization is needed? Local pros typically assess signs such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ors that don’t close properly to determine if stabilization services are necessary.
What techniques are used for foundation stabilization?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and installing helical or push piers to provide additional support to the foundation.
Are foundation stabilization services suitable for all types of foundations? These services are generally applicable to various foundation types, including concrete slab, crawl space, and basement foundations, depending on the specific issues.
